ABSTRACT:
A method for dressing a grinding wheel by providing a slurry of liquid and solid particles wherein the particle size is smaller than grain size of the grinding wheel and the particles are free of sharp edges, and blasting the slurry at low pressure through a blasting nozzle onto a surface of the grinding wheel to remove foreign material on the grinding wheel by impact and by cleaning action of the blasted stream.
